Loni Carl Obituary

Loni W. Carl, 81, passed away on Friday, November 2, 2012, atthe Rainbow Hospice Inpatient Center in Johnson Creek, Wisconsin,surrounded by his loving family.

Loni was born on February 3, 1931, in Kassel, Germany, to Rudolf and Anna Carl. On November 1, 1957, he married Hildegard Borkowski. They celebrated 55 years of marriage one day prior to his death.

In 1963, Loni and Hilda immigrated to Fort Atkinson. During this time, Loni was employed at Jamesway and at Carnation in Jefferson. In 1977, they purchased Dorn's Liquor; which they owned and operated as Carl's Liquor Store until 1992, at which time they both retired.

Loni always had a passion for "hobby farming", loved to travel and was an avid Packers fan and owner.
